Portfolio Production Project: Final Images


For the past few months I've been working on a project for my Photography degree called Portfolio Production. For this project I had to write my own brief to produce a portfolio of images on a chosen subject.

I wanted to create a series of documentary portraits focusing on local cosplayers but portraying them as themselves rather than as the characters they are portraying.

I initially set out to create a series of photos of cosplayer in there normal clothes looking into a mirror and seeing there reflection in costume. Initially I liked this idea but my tutors thought it was too complicated and that a simpler image would have more impact.

I wanted to try and do the series on location with the model in costume but in a normal situation. However, I didn't have enough models interested to fulfil the criteria of the brief. Another idea I wanted to try was to shoot a model in and out of costume in the studio and because this idea was far more popular I decided to pursue this avenue and ended up shooting 12 models. 

I shot this in my college's studio using a D610 camera. I decided to use a high-key set-up but after I experimented with a practice shoot I thought a mid-key set-up and black and white filter would set the two images apart and a graduated grey background would work better on the black and white image.
